关于 Nefh

功能概要

Enables protein-macromolecule adaptor activity and toxic substance binding activity. A structural constituent of Cytoskeleton. Involved in several processes, including cellular response to estradiol stimulus; nervous system development; and ovarian follicle atresia. Located in several cellular components, including dendrite; intermediate filament; and perikaryon. Used to study congenital hypothyroidism. Biomarker of glaucoma; hypothyroidism; phenylketonuria; sciatic neuropathy; and transient cerebral ischemia. Human ortholog(s) of this gene implicated in Charcot-Marie-Tooth disease axonal type 2CC; amyotrophic lateral sclerosis; amyotrophic lateral sclerosis type 1; and monoclonal gammopathy of uncertain significance. Orthologous to human NEFH (neurofilament heavy chain). [provided by Alliance of Genome Resources, Apr 2022]
